Hillen, Baltimore, MD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hillen?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Hillen Studio Apartments | $1,226 | $850 | $2,000 |
| Hillen 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,252 | $550 | $3,500 |
| Hillen 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,558 | $895 | $2,650 |
| Hillen 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,267 | $1,450 | $3,545 |
| Hillen 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,237 | $1,950 | $3,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Hillen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Hillen with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Hillen is at Oak Hill Townhomes listed at $850.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Hillen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Hillen is $1,226.
What is the largest available Studio Hillen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Hillen is a 2,377 square feet unit starting from $950 at 3007 N Calvert St.
